Ginger Slice - No Bake
Description
The Ginger Slice is a layered no-bake dessert made by crushing gingernut biscuits to form the base mixed with melted butter, condensed milk, golden syrup, and optional ground ginger for warmth. This mixture is pressed into a prepared tin and chilled to set the base layer quickly.
A chocolate topping made from melted dark chocolate and butter is poured evenly over the biscuit layer to create a glossy, rich finish. After refrigerating for approximately two hours, the slice becomes firm enough to cut.
This dessert blends the warm spice of ginger with creamy sweetness and crisp biscuit texture. It does not require traditional baking, making it convenient for home cooks. Variations include substituting the optional ground ginger or using milk chocolate instead of dark chocolate for the topping.
The slice is best made in a standard 20cm (8") square tin for thickness but can adapt to similar containers. It keeps well chilled and serves as a treat for casual or festive occasions.
Ingredients
- 250 g gingernut biscuits
- 80 g condensed milk
- 70 g butter salted
- 1 tablespoon golden syrup
- 1 teaspoon ground ginger optional
Chocolate topping
- 200 g dark chocolate
- 50 g butter salted
Instructions
- Grease and line a 20cm (8") square cake tin and set aside (see my notes).
- Place Gingernut biscuits in a food processor, then process into crumbs then set aside.
- In a large microwave safe bowl, melt butter then add condensed milk and ground ginger and mix. Then add golden syrup and mix to incorporate.
- Add biscuits crumbs and mix together well. Press biscuit mixture into the base of your tin, and place the tin in the fridge to start setting, while you melt the chocolate for the topping.
- Place dark chocolate into a microwave safe bowl, along with the remaining butter. Microwave in 30 second bursts (stirring between bursts with a metal spoon) until chocolate is melted and smooth.
- Pour chocolate in an even layer over the top of the biscuit layer, smooth the top and refrigerate for 2 hours or until set.
Notes
- Any suitable container can be used for this no-bake slice since it does not require oven baking.
- Adjust the size of the container to control layer thickness; smaller tins yield thicker slices, larger ones thinner.
- The ground ginger is optional but adds a distinct warm flavor that complements the biscuits and chocolate.
- You can substitute dark chocolate with milk chocolate for a milder topping.
- Calorie estimates per serving are approximate, varying by brand and ingredient specifics.
